In the world of Geographic Information Systems (GIS), the gap between technical data analysis and effective visual communication is often wider than it appears. A GIS analyst can possess the most accurate spatial data in the world, but if they cannot present it in a way that is accessible, aesthetically pleasing, and logically structured, the message is lost.
